
An unmissable cinerassegna on May 29 from 9 to greet the project “Once upon a time in Sicily” which in recent months has involved students from Palermo and Enna in a journey of discovery of cinema and audiovisual through meetings with directors, videos editors, producers, directors of photography of the caliber of Daniele Ciprì and Pif.
During the day, which will take place at the Rouge et noir cinema, the young students will meet Ivan Scinardo, director of the Palermo Experimental Cinematography Center, Nicola Tarantino, director of the Sicily film commission and Soldi Spicci, the duo who have chosen cinema as a means to tell their comedy.
The films “It was the son” by Daniele Ciprì, “Sicilian Ghost Story” by Fabio Grassadonia and Antonio Piazza and “Magic show” with Nino Frassica will be screened in a real film marathon.
Last, but not least, there will be the first viewing of the short film made by the students involved in the “Once upon a time in Sicily” project, created as part of the National Cinema and Image Plan for schools promoted by MiC and MiM.
The short film was shot in Palermo at the end of April with the direction and screenplay signed by the students themselves with the contribution of the teachers involved. A project that has allowed many young people to be able to see how a film project is born.
